Event Details for the Annual Boulder Polar Bear Club’s New Year’s Day Ice Swim

Where: On the boat ramp on the south end of Boulder Reservoir

When: The event begins at 12:00 noon on January 1st, New Year’s Day, and lasts until 2:00 PM. You can arrive as early as 11:00 AM to register.

How to get there:
Take Highway 119 north from Boulder to Jay Rd., then go west a short distance and then turn north on 51 St. Go approximately 3.4 miles to the west entrance of Boulder Reservoir, turn in and travel east along the south side of the reservoir to the boat ramp.

Fees: $15 for adults age 19 and up, $10 for teens 13 to 18, & $5 for children 12 and under. We take cash or checks, no credit cards.

Bring: Swimwear, a couple of towels, shoes to wear in the water, warm clothes, and a sense of humor. The registration and the line may take some time, so dress warmly, since the weather conditions are unknown. The shoes to wear in the water protect numb feet against rocks and uneven ground. We typically provide hot tea, coffee, and bagels.
